So this is the first in my wedding series and I’m so excited
to be able to share my wedding with you!
I have been married 6 months already, I was married on 26th
April 2014 at St Mary’s Church in Sawston and the reception was at Chippenham
Park near Cambridge.
My first wedding post will be on the dress!
I kind of had an idea on a dress I loved when I first got engaged;
I originally loved the Ellis Bridals 11135. We were wedding planning for 3
years so after a while it changed a few times!
I’ve never been into the big princess dresses; I always
loved the fishtail fitted dresses, something a bit different.
Finding the right dress shop:
I searched for wedding dress shops in my local area that
stocked Ellis Bridals, I loved so many of their dresses. I found Fleur De Lys Bridal in Saffron Walden, they had some really nice styles on their website
and had good reviews, I felt really nervous about dress shopping and kept putting
it off, I left it quite late in the end didn’t end up dress shopping until November
2013.
I was lucky enough to win £500 towards a dress which was so
exciting! I feel so lucky to have won. Winning also gave me the kick I needed
to get dress shopping!
Visiting the shop:
I visited the shop with my mum, sister & nan and I had the best time and
some great memories of the whole experience of dress shopping.
The ladies who work at Fleur De Lys Bridal are so lovely and
friendly and couldn't do enough to help me. They were very honest with what
suited me and what didn't. When I walked in I was greeted by two very friendly
ladies. I chose around 7 dresses I wanted to try on, I had written down a few
styles I wanted to try so the ladies helped me find them and also suggested styles
I might like. I went shopping knowing what dress I wanted and I tried that
dress on first and after trying on around 7 dresses, I chose the first dress I
tried on.
The dress:
I chose the Ellis Bridals 11368, a beautiful full length lace fish tail dress
with lace arms and a cut out back detail. I felt amazing in it and I just knew
it was perfect from the moment I saw it.
I then chose a long length veil with small diamantes all
over, I felt that with the cut out back detailing of the dress, that a long
length veil would look better than a short veil, they flowed nicely together
and could still see the cut out back detailing through the veil, they just
looked perfect together!
The shoes:
As my colour theme was pastel pink, I always knew I wanted pink shoes. I found
a stunning pair of embellished peep toe sling backs in Debenhams in a beautiful
dusk pink colour, they were perfect (but really hurt my feet on the wedding
day!)
